Located in the heart of Fishers, adjacent to the Nickel Plate Trail, Hub & Spoke is a unique 94,000 square feet master-planned mixed-use development and partnership with the City of Fishers. It consists of a design center, coworking, and a makerspace.
The DESIGN CENTER is the project’s anchor consisting of retail showrooms where homeowners and trade professionals will be able to shop for all the latest products in home improvement from flooring, cabinetry, countertops, window treatments, plumbing fixtures, and lighting to so much more.
COWORKING – The Community Connect fosters creativity, connection, collaboration, and the freedom and flexibility people and businesses need to accomplish more. Our indoor and outdoor event center provides community and industry recreational and educational events.
Our MAKERSPACE is a nonprofit community workshop, innovation lab, and art studio where we will provide S.T.E.A.M. based hands-on experiential exploration and learning to develop a skilled workforce. At Hub & Spoke students and adults will be given opportunities to explore the skilled trades as a rewarding career.
